You could use
http://www.bayes.co.uk/xml/index.xml?/xml/utils/dirtoxml.xml to get a
representation of a directory tree and then use a transform like
http://www.bayes.co.uk/xml/index.xml?/xml/utils/xmltoftp.xml to write a
script file to do the transformations
